Wow! I am overwhelmed by the love here. It has been two of the scariest weeks of my life, from diagnosis to surgery. I have felt the support from the get go. We were very fortunate to be referred to Dr. Chmait, a leader in his field and now Dr. Sklansky, head of fetal cardiology at Children's Hospital, Los Angeles. Our boys are fighters. Dean had the situation reversed- the donor baby is the small one. He was not keeping his blood, but 'transfusing' it to the recipient, larger baby.

Though the playoffs continue and names are not final, I've been calling them Wyatt and Trevor. Wyatt (donor) means little warrior and Trevor (recipient) means prudent ;).

The surgery was under 2 hours and I was awake. I was able to see the boys in 3d. Truly an amazing experience. The next 4 weeks will tell a lot. We expect to see Wyatt increase his fluid, which he has already begun doing. In 5 weeks we will see Dr. Sklansky and check Trevor's heart. There are abnormalities, but may very well correct itself. All symptons of TTTS.

Dean and I are so appreciative to have your kindness in our lives. We have been through a lot in a short period of time and are so lucky to have one another and y'all. Thank you so much!
